'Da Adriano' Chef Cooks Up New Restaurant In Lenox Hill

Ciao bella.

UPPER EAST SIDE, NY — A new Italian restaurant from the owner of neighborhood staple da Adriano is one step closer to opening on the Upper East Side.

La Colina, which will be located at 1431 First Ave. between East 74th and East 75th streets, won support from Community Board 8's Street Life Committee on Tuesday night as part of its application for a liquor license.

The recommendation now heads to the New York State Liquor Authority for final approval.

The restaurant will take over the space currently occupied by Gnocchi House Bar, which opened in 2025.

Robert Callahan, a representative of La Colina, told the committee the new eatery will have 23 tables and a small seven-seat bar.

"We will be a quiet Italian restaurant," Callahan said.

The restaurant expects to be open daily from 11 a.m. to 11 p.m.

The restaurant will be led by Adrian Kercuku, who has operated da Adriano since 2023, Callahan said.

For the uninitiated, da Adriano is a relaxed neighborhood restaurant that serves housemade focaccia, a rotating menu of sandwiches, salads, pastas, as well as café fare.

When it opened in 2023, Kercuku told Patch the focus was on quality and community.

"We want to be like some kind of small spot which we can offer it like the best quality and, and the people to come in really easy things," Kercuku said at the time.

La Colina also plans to retain Gnocchi House's existing staff, Callahan said.

No word yet on when La Colina plans to open.
